Mycobacterium leprae ML0314c LipU Secreted carboxyl esterase

Comment

ML0314c showed preference for short carbon chain substrates with maximum activity for pNP-acetate. Secreted carboxyl esterase that could modulate the immune response in leprosy patients. Inhibited by Eserine, DEPC and Orlistat
